What Happened
Officer Duross suffered a fatal heart attack shortly after being involved in a vehicle pursuit. He collapsed shortly after returning to the police station at the intersection of 39th Street and Lancaster Avenue. Officer Duross was U.S. Navy veteran and had served with the Philadelphia Police Department for 10 years.
Survivors
He was survived by his wife, daughter, and son.
